Output 3d2bdebb95bd9525056a6ec30f42d02097e13a048806ae841b9149246443ad68:52

value
43145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ead21e05bbd55494554e7634ef6f477fa22cfdb OP_EQUAL
address
37QRDt8ds4KpykzKvX3qtR86RfhwLQMMQd
transaction
3d2bdebb95bd9525056a6ec30f42d02097e13a048806ae841b9149246443ad68
spent
true